Home
last modified time | relevance | path

Searched defs:VsockStream (Results 1 – 3 of 3) sorted by relevance

/external/rust/crates/vsock/src/
Dlib.rs61 fn next(&mut self) -> Option<Result<VsockStream>> { in next()
108 pub fn accept(&self) -> Result<(VsockStream, VsockAddr)> { in accept()
189 pub struct VsockStream { struct
193 impl VsockStream { argument
304 impl Read for VsockStream { implementation
310 impl Write for VsockStream { implementation
320 impl Read for &VsockStream { implementation
326 impl Write for &VsockStream { implementation
336 impl AsRawFd for VsockStream { implementation
342 impl FromRawFd for VsockStream { implementation
[all …]
/external/libchromeos-rs/src/
Dvsock.rs246 pub fn connect<A: ToSocketAddr>(self, addr: A) -> io::Result<VsockStream> { in connect()
347 pub struct VsockStream { struct
351 impl VsockStream { impl
352 pub fn connect<A: ToSocketAddr>(addr: A) -> io::Result<VsockStream> { in connect()
362 pub fn try_clone(&self) -> io::Result<VsockStream> { in try_clone()
371 impl io::Read for VsockStream { implementation
389 impl io::Write for VsockStream { implementation
412 impl AsRawFd for VsockStream { implementation
418 impl IntoRawFd for VsockStream { implementation
447 pub fn accept(&self) -> io::Result<(VsockStream, SocketAddr)> { in accept()
/external/crosvm/base/src/sys/unix/
Dvsock.rs256 pub fn connect<A: ToSocketAddr>(self, addr: A) -> io::Result<VsockStream> { in connect()
359 pub struct VsockStream { struct
363 impl VsockStream { impl
364 pub fn connect<A: ToSocketAddr>(addr: A) -> io::Result<VsockStream> { in connect()
374 pub fn try_clone(&self) -> io::Result<VsockStream> { in try_clone()
383 impl io::Read for VsockStream { implementation
401 impl io::Write for VsockStream { implementation
424 impl AsRawFd for VsockStream { implementation
430 impl IntoRawFd for VsockStream { implementation
459 pub fn accept(&self) -> io::Result<(VsockStream, SocketAddr)> { in accept()